fetch hardware status on load, so we have the psram setting

This commit is contained in:
proddy
2024-07-26 13:23:47 +02:00
parent ae7737e47b
commit 3f6157d7a4

View File

@@ -50,6 +50,10 @@ export function boardProfileSelectItems() {
} }
const ApplicationSettings: FC = () => { const ApplicationSettings: FC = () => {
const { data: hardwareData, error } = useRequest(SystemApi.readHardwareStatus, {
force: true
});
const { const {
loadData, loadData,
saveData, saveData,
@@ -835,7 +839,7 @@ const ApplicationSettings: FC = () => {
checked={data.modbus_enabled} checked={data.modbus_enabled}
onChange={updateFormValue} onChange={updateFormValue}
name="modbus_enabled" name="modbus_enabled"
disabled={saving} disabled={!hardwareData.psram}
/> />
} }
label={LL.ENABLE_MODBUS()} label={LL.ENABLE_MODBUS()}